Frontend Engineer

At Epignosis, we build workplace learning software that enables more than 70,000 teams worldwide to offer training to millions of people. Our portfolio of tools can be used by organizations of any size and includes TalentLMS - a zero-overhead cloud LMS, eFront - an enterprise LMS, TalentCards - a mobile app for training the deskless workforce, and TalentHR - a lightweight HRIS to manage people ops. We are competing with the world’s top eLearning solutions and we aim at becoming world’s #1.

We're on a mission to democratize training by developing simple, accessible, and affordable software. We count 12.000+ companies as customers and with more than 11 million users logging in to use our platforms, we are a much-loved global leader in learning tech. At home, we are quickly becoming one of the largest SaaS company to come out of Greece.

We are looking for a Frontend Engineer (VueJS) to join our efront team.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in Vue.js 3, Webpack, Tailwind CSS, as well as a strong understanding of web development best practices. They will be responsible for working closely with fellow developers, as well as our product and design teams to ensure that our applications are both functional and user-friendly.

Responsibilities

As a Frontend Engineer (VueJS), you will:

  • Modernize our monolithic application. Extend functionalities and create new features.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and business requirements and translate them into modern frontend solutions.
  • Refactor and optimize existing code written in jQuery and plain JS, integrating Webpack, Vue.js 3, Tailwind CSS.
  • Develop new frontend features and functionalities.
  • Implement responsive designs and create seamless user interfaces across multiple devices and browsers.
  • Conduct code reviews, provide constructive feedback, and ensure adherence to coding standards.
  • Stay updated with emerging frontend technologies, share knowledge, and contribute to the team’s growth.
  • Collaborate on UI/UX discussions, leveraging your insights and expertise to enhance the user experience.

To be successful in this role as a Frontend Engineer (VueJS), you should:

  • 2 years of proven working experience in frontend development and a willingness to work with Vue.js.
  • Proficient understanding of HTML5, CSS3, and JavaScript, with a focus on writing clean and scalable code.
  • Knowledge of responsive web design principles, cross-browser compatibility, and accessibility standards.
  • Demonstrate autonomy and require minimal guidance.
  • Adapt to changing project requirements and priorities.
  • Take ownership of your work and manage time effectively to meet deadlines.
  • Communicate technical concepts clearly to non-technical stakeholders and be a strong team player.
  • Exhibit strong problem-solving skills, critical thinking, and attention to detail.

Bonus points

  • Experience modernizing monolithic applications, understanding the challenges and best practices involved.
  • Solid understanding of version control using GitHub.
  • Familiarity with Docker.
